    In the upcoming primary election, Chuck Pike is one of the best candidates running for the Delaware Valley School Board. Chuck is running for the two-year term and is an excellent choice to receive your vote. Chuck has been a resident of the Delaware Valley School District for 27 years. He has raised four children through the district and has been involved in nearly every aspect of their journey through education. Chuck has been a school board director in the past and is ready to take on the challenge again. Chuck has been involved in numerous activities including coaching Delaware Valley Babe Ruth baseball for 11 years, PAYAL football, Pop Warner football and organized the DVES PTA Basketball program for 6 years. He is also an active member of St. Joseph’s Church for 24 years, a Eucharist Minister of 16 years and currently serves on the Parish Finance Council. My personal experience with Chuck is through Odyssey of the Mind in which he has coached several teams throughout my time at Delaware Valley. He helped guide my team the past two years to a state championship and a high school record placement at World Finals. The only time Chuck did not attend a meeting with the team was when he was on a business trip or on Thursdays when he attends board meetings; his dedication is impeccable, intriguing and inspiring. The guidance and support that he provided our team was invaluable. Chuck believes the public education system is the cornerstone of our society and must be maintained as strong as possible. Chuck has a great understanding of the students at our school, whether it be our student athletes, students who are involved in extra/co-curricula’s or any student who is actively involved in the community and school, as well as teachers and support staff. The dedication and experience Chuck has to our community and school district makes him one of the most qualified candidates who is most in touch with the needs of the taxpayers, the students and the district as a whole.
